Harold Higuchi

Harold Akio Higuchi, 78, of Hilo died Jan. 28, 2013, at Yukio Okutsu State Veterans Home in Hilo. Born May 28, 1934, in Hilo, he was a retired cook and member of the Waiakea Pirates.

Private services were held. Family requests no flowers or monetary offerings.

He is survived by wife, Maureen Higuchi of Honolulu; son, Glenn Higuchi of California; daughters, Jeri (Steve) Mosley of Maui, Gail (John) Miyao of Honolulu; brother, Albert Higuchi of Washington state; sisters, Tsutae Nonaka, Chizuru (Joe) Sugawara and Setsuko Isa, all of Hilo, Kaoru (Yoshiharu) Mikami and Carol Yano, both of Honolulu; four grandchildren; numerous nephews, nieces and cousins.

Arrangements by Dodo Mortuary.
